KANSAS CITY, Mo. — Thursday was full of World Cup successes for Kansas City with an estimated 36,000 people participating in the Oranje Fan Walk and about 70,000 more attending the Tunisia vs. Netherland’s match.
But the weather presented challenges for KC2026 which had to delay buses and close Fan Fest very early as a result.
